Participating Artists
Each summer, Marlboro gathers some 85 exceptionally talented instrumentalists and singers of widely varying ages, backgrounds and points of view. New musical leaders are joined by eminent concert artists from around the world, who live together for seven weeks as one nurturing and closely-knit family.
While in residence, the artists have the rare luxury of virtually unlimited time to rehearse works of their own choosing from the vast chamber music repertoire. These special, in-depth collaborations allow the musicians to exchange ideas, test new approaches, get to the heart of the music, and make lasting discoveries. After three weeks of rehearsals, Marlboro shares its music-making on five weekends of public concerts.
Marlboro performances are also heard through our off-season Musicians From Marlboro national touring program and on radio broadcasts, recordings and streaming from our website.
